This morning:

Over three thousand people have signed a petition supporting Westbury's Victorian Swimming Pool. Despite no decision being made over future funding, it has been suggested it be run by the community and not the council. Matthew spoke to Bob Lee from the Save the Pool campaign.

The Caen Hill flight of locks on the Kennet and Avon is a no through route for boat owners after lock gates were damaged by a narrowboat. We were live on the canal to look at the implications for people stuck at either end.

And we heard about today's parade to give the freedom of Malmesbury to Nine Royal Logistics Corps who are based at Hullavington.
